導航:首頁 > 編程大全 > 資料庫查詢統計數量

資料庫查詢統計數量

發布時間:2022-01-20 09:31:17

㈠ SQL 資料庫中如何統計指定數據的個數 高分急尋

select count(1) from table_name where 姓名1 = 'mary' +
select count(1) from table_name where 姓名2 = 'mary' +
select count(1) from table_name where 姓名3 = 'mary'+
select count(1) from table_name where 姓名4 = 'mary'+
select count(1) from table_name where 姓名5 = 'mary'

select count(*)
from (
select name1 from table_name
union all
select name2 from table_name
union all
select name3 from table_name
union all
select name4 from table_name
union all
select name5 from table_name
) t
where name1='mary'
笨而簡單的方法,想一步完成,寫個函數吧

㈡ SQL 統計數量

--表A和表B分開來統計,最後合並兩個統計結果
時間在一個范圍內用 時間A between '時間1' and '時間2'
由於不是很明白你的分組統計原則,所以group by語句暫時無法提供建議

㈢ 用sql語句統計資料庫某個欄位中相同的數據有多少條

用分組,組內計數就可以了,意思就是根據欄位a的取值進行分組,相同的為一組,在用count進行組內計數。

select a,count(*)

from A

group by a

(3)資料庫查詢統計數量擴展閱讀:

SQL統計重復數據

1、生成表

CREATE TABLE TEST1 (

COL1 CHAR(2),

COL2 INT

)

GO

2、插入數據

INSERT INTO TEST1 VALUES('AA', 1000);

INSERT INTO TEST1 VALUES('AA', 2000);

INSERT INTO TEST1 VALUES('AA', 3000);

INSERT INTO TEST1 VALUES('BB', 1100);

INSERT INTO TEST1 VALUES('BB', 1200);

INSERT INTO TEST1 VALUES('CC', 1300);

3、統計重復數據(找出有重復的值)

SELECT COL1, COUNT(COL1) 重復數量

FROM TEST1

GROUP BY COL1

HAVING COUNT(COL1) > 1

ORDER BY COL1;

4、查詢結果

COL1 重復數量

AA 3

BB 2

㈣ mysql中分類查詢統計數量

我試過了,一條語句我做不到,join union不行,條件語句也不行,分成四段,單人間版/多人間/情侶間權/總統間,最後合在一起就行了

SELECT hid,count(*) as '單人間數' FROM `hotelinfo` WHERE type=1 GROUP BY hid;

SELECT hid,count(*) as '雙人間數' FROM `hotelinfo` WHERE type=2 GROUP BY hid;
。。。。。

㈤ sql資料庫中多表如何統計總數

select * from A inner join B on (A.Id=B.Aid) where A.age<16 and B.所選課程=數學
(A.Id=B.Aid)是A表和B表的關系
Sql語句是這樣的

㈥ sql語句統計數量,統計一個欄位的值的數量

select type,count(*) as 總數量,
sum(case when level='一級' then 1 else 0 end) as 一級,
sum(case when level='二級' then 1 else 0 end) as 二級,
sum(case when level='三級' then 1 else 0 end) as 三級
from table group by type

樓上的應該改改吧

㈦ 資料庫中如何查詢某個表的總人數

select sum(人數) from 表名
如果你有欄位名,或者其他需要,可再聯系我。

㈧ sql語句統計查詢結果數量怎麼寫

可以通過count函數來實現。

sqlOne:select * from tablename1 where id>5;此語句查詢出來多條記錄,之後看做一個新的表。

sqlTwo:select conut(*) from (select * from tablename1 where id>5) as tablename2;此語句即可查詢出來統計的記錄條數。

備註:以上方法通用於所有的數據統計,如果是單表查詢,可以直接通過:「select count( *) from tablename1 where id>5"的形式查詢出結果。

㈨ SQL語句如何統計資料庫當日信息數量

用分組,組內計數就可以了,意思就是根據欄位a的取值進行分組,相同的為一組,在用count進行組內計數
select
a,count(*)
from
a
group
by
a

閱讀全文

與資料庫查詢統計數量相關的資料

熱點內容
汽車安卓導航懸浮 瀏覽:481
ps用快速蒙版調文件里黑白色 瀏覽:746
蘋果6iphone解鎖無法開啟 瀏覽:201
高通模式線刷工具 瀏覽:40
打開pDF顯示檢查文件許可權 瀏覽:825
怎麼刪除文件名中指定字元 瀏覽:595
圖片如何轉化文件格式 瀏覽:859
無貨源鋪貨有哪些app 瀏覽:316
30g的文件可以保存在哪裡 瀏覽:329
不同文件夾的pdf怎麼批量拆分 瀏覽:98
順豐速運文件到付多少錢 瀏覽:892
安裝的app在哪裡看 瀏覽:773
流量包和數據包什麼區別 瀏覽:851
編程語言事先定義好是什麼意思 瀏覽:919
怎麼轉換qlv文件 瀏覽:516
大眾網關版本 瀏覽:832
編程為什麼要用佔位符 瀏覽:108
bat批量創建文件 瀏覽:713
學編程的最強的奧義是什麼 瀏覽:336
access怎麼導出資料庫文件 瀏覽:356

友情鏈接